Can a song on ACR get back onto SCR?

Yes. A song on ACR can be reset to SCR if it experiences an increase in streams 25% greater than the market change week on week, provided it is within 3 years of its release. The song will be reset on the week it experiences the increase.

 

New rule: Any song (excluding Christmas songs) older than 3 years may be automatically reset under the same circumstances if the track has not charted in the Top 100 singles chart within the past 3 years.

 

In exceptional circumstances a record label may request a manual reset to SCR. Manual reset shall be strictly subject to Official Charts and CSC approval. If the label have any good reason for resetting the track (such as the release of a music video or it getting TikTok vitality), it will get one.

 

But won't a load of songs get resets in January once people stop listening to Christmas songs?

The OCC changed the rules from 2021 regarding January resets. What has happened in previous years is songs that have peaked long ago, but still fall within 3 years of release, got resets due to the year-end effect. One example of this in 2020 was Ed Sheeran's Perfect (which infamously continued to avoid ACR for over half the year, until it reached 3 years since it had its official single push and thus fell foul of that rule). To avoid this, the ACR automatic reset process is paused for the Xmas–NewYear transition, and the OCC invite labels to nominate tracks they wish to continue to promote and thus give a reset to. For example in 2021, manual resets caused Dua Lipa's 'Levitating' to re-peak at #5, Tate McCrae's 'You Broke Me First' to return to the top 10, amongst other re-entries in the top 40.
